Distinguish: between current account and capital account,
Answer»
Current Account
Capital Account
Maintains the records of imports and exports of goods and services as well as the record of unilateral transfers.
Records all the transactions that cause a change in the status of assets and liabilities of the government or any of the residents of a country.
Components: Export ar-rd Import of Goods Export and Import of Services Unilateral transfers
Components: FDI and Portfolio Investment Loans and Borrowings Banking Capital Transactions
Exports of Goods and services = Imports of goods and Services => Current Account Surplus Export of Goods and Services < Imports of Goods and Services => Current Account Deficit
Net Capital Inflow => Capital Account Surplus Net Capital Outflow => Capital Account Deficit
